Oh contraire. I'm measuring a 45 70 case now with 13grains of red dot. With a 405gr bullet properly seated, there's only 1/3 of the case empty. That's the charge recommended for the rolling block. Also, not enough empty space for an accidental double charge of 12 or 13 grains of red dot. Look at the difference in length between a 250 and a 405grain round..

Before dad became an owner/operator in trucking he drove for Haskell Linen, now Mission Linen. In the late '50s thru the mid '70s he drove a route collecting those hand towels plus rugs and shop rags from every saloon, commercial kitchen and mine from Tucson to Nogales. Then it all had to be sorted and counted before being delivered to the plant laundry. I honestly don't recall him getting sick. In fact, he lived into his 90s.
